Plant Care
- Sunlight: Partial Shade to Bright Indirect Light
- Watering: Moderate watering; keep the soil evenly moist but well-drained
- Soil: Fertile, organic-rich, and well-draining soil
- Maintenance: Remove dry leaves regularly and apply organic compost occasionally to encourage healthy growth
